Evaluation of the impact of changing the number of test tasks on successful completion for automated LMS

Trpimir Alajbeg, Mladen Sokele, Denis Martinić

Sažetak

Based on the directions for time criteria optimization obtained by previous research related to LMS automated assessment, the task corpus was increased to ensure better class material coverage. In actual academic year on Personal Computer Applications (PCA) course in professional study of electrical engineering at Zagreb University of Applied Sciences, results from exams with the new parameters, were obtained. Statistical data analysis was carried out with the focus on the following explanatory parameters: number of students solving test, number of successful attempts, characteristic duration of test and overall test duration. Results of abovementioned analysis, presented in the paper, give the possibility for quantitative estimation how the changed parameters affect the test dynamic solving and the success of passing the exam.
